When Looking For Real Estate Follow the 24 Hour Rule

By
Real Estate Agent with Better Homes and Gardens Rand Realty

One of the great things about working with a buyer's agent in real estate is being able to schedule a tour of the listings available in your price range regardless of what real estate broker has them listed. One call from you and your agent will check availability, plan a route, call for appointments, and save you valuable time.  It is important to work with your agent to schedule these showings in advance.  Knowing the area allows me to plan a route to save time and gas.

  • First and foremost, is that many residential listings are occupied by families trying to live while hoping to sell their homes.  They often need a bit of notice to prepare the home for you to see. They may have pets that need to be contained or they may have to straighten up prior to showings.  


  • I need time to plan our route and make those appointments.  If you call me and say you want to see 5 houses and you are arriving at my office in 5 minutes to start I won't have time to get things together for you.


  • I am working with other clients too.  I need to allow time for all of the things that I am required to do in order to be successful for them and for you. I do all of my own follow up on offers, contracts, and I try to be the one with my clients throughout the buying process.  This I need to arrange my days ahead of time so that I can fit everything in and give each client the attention that they deserve.


  • I have a family and other things that I do outside of my career.  While I want to give you the best service I can I need time for personal obligations too.  I, like you, want some personal time.  I don't have regularly scheduled days off.  I usually can be found working in between or even during my personal time much to the aggravation of my family when that cell phone rings, but I do have to take that valuable time to recharge and renew.


So please understand how much I want to do the best job possible for you and find you the real estate you want to buy but allow me enough time to make your experience as stress free for both of us as possible.  If you follow the 24 Hour Rule we will both win!
